Effects of Feeding Patterns on Growth,Food Intake and Immunity of Halfsmooth Tongue-sole Cynoglossus semilaevis and on Water Quality in an Industrial Aquaculture

Abstract:The 5 × 2 two‐factor random animal experiment was conducted in the industrial culture condition with closed recirculation aquaculture system for 56 days to investigate the effect of monthly satiation de‐gree (MSD) and daily feeding ratio(DFR) on growth ,water quality ,food intake and immunity of juvenile halfsmoth tongue‐sole Cynoglossus semilaevis Günther with body weight of (291 .47 ± 4 .23) g and to ex‐plore an optimal feeding mode to improve efficiency of economy and ecology .The juveniles were fed at four levels of 80% ,90% ,100% ,and 110% of M SD and tw o levels of DFR including 3 times a day at a ratio of 42(first)∶29 (second)∶29(third) ,and 1∶1∶1 ,equal amount each time ,with 8 triplicate treatments . The results showed that MSD had very significant effect on daily weight gain (DWG) ,specific growth rate (SGR) and daily food intake(DFI) (P<0 .01) ,and that DFR also had significant effect on DWG ,SGR and food conversion ratio (FCR)(P<0.05) .Under inequality feeding ,there were 53 .68% higher DWG and 37 .31% higher SGR in 100% MSD than 80% MSD (P<0 .01) .In equality feeding ,however ,there were 43 .73% higher DWG and 36 .11% higher SGR in 100% MSD than 80% MSD (P<0.01) ,with the maxi‐mal daily weigh gain (3 .60 ± 0 .18) g under 100% MSD and equality feeding .Both MAD and DFR showed significant effect on the relative concentration of ammonia in water (P<0 .01) .There were 72 .22% higher (inequality feeding) (P<0 .05) and 117 .77% higher (equality feeding)(P<0.01)relative concentration of ammonia at 110% level than 90% level ,the maximal concentration of ammonia at 110% level .Both DFR and MSD had no significant effect on activities of lysozyme and superoxide dismutase (SOD) .It is conclu‐ded that feeding of 90% monthly satiation degree with different amount feeding is suitable for both grow th and water environment ,and that the combination feeding of 100% monthly satiation degree with equiva‐lence feeding is used for the best grow th .
